  FIG. 5. Immunohistochemical analysis of X. laevis skin. A and C, positive staining (brown) of the epidermis (e), granular glands (g), and regenerating granular glands (arrows) with antiserum SKP-2. Mucous glands (m) show no immunoreactivity. B, no signals were obtained after staining with the preimmune serum. Scale bars are 100 pm A and B) and 50 pm (C).
